We estimate 9-10 sheet, ..:i:. 32" x 32" overall, will cover the entire area. <br /> <br />Map Accuracy and Liability <br /> <br />By accepting this proposal, you agree the work described herein will meet your intended <br />purpose. The use of this map for a purpose other than that which is originally designed <br />may render the map unreliable. <br /> <br />Except where the ground may be obscured, map accuracy will comply with National Map <br />Accuracy Standards. Briefly, these state that 90% of all well defined features shall be <br />correct within 1/30 inch, and 90% of all elevations correct within 1/2-contour interval. If <br />areas are obscured, contours will be dashed to indicate they are approximate. The <br />accuracy standards should be applied only to the basic scale and contour interval 1" _ <br />100', 2' C.!. for which the maps were designed. <br /> <br />MARKHURD's liability, in the production or use of these maps, for any inaccuracies that <br />may be found in these maps, shall be limited to the correction of such inaccuracies, and <br />shall not exceed the contract value of the maps.
